Consider the ease with which you can make your toll free conference calls
You want to be able to make your conference calls reliably and with ease. In addition, you want to have specific features for your associates. Consider recorded play back for training sessions or roll call to make sure you know whose attending the calls. Make a list of features you need and seriously consider whether you'll use each feature before you sign up for them.

Customer service counts
There will be times when you have questions regarding your teleconferencing service. Select a company that provides readily available customer service so you can get the answers you need when you need them, allowing you to continue to focus on your work rather than your conference calls.

Take advantage of free trials
Several teleconferencing services offer free trials. Take advantage of those free trials so you can use and evaluate the services provided. Free trials allow you to test the conference call services, the ease with which you can use them and their reliability prior to signing a contract for long-term conference call services.
